SUMMARY
When switching from Browse mode to View mode, Gwenview will unmaximize the
window if it was previously maximized

STEPS TO REPRODUCE
1. Open Gwenview
2. Make sure in Browse mode
3. Maximise the window
4. Open an image, which will enter View mode

OBSERVED RESULT
The window is no longer maximized, even though it still takes up the whole
screen.

EXPECTED RESULT
The window is still maximized.

ADDITIONAL INFORMATION
This is a problem because the not-quite-maximized window has the window
controls in a slightly different place. So if you move the cursor to the very
top-right corner of the screen, the window close button is not highlighted (it
would be highlighted if the window was maximized), requiring a small additional
mouse movement before you can close the window.
